How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Smoketown?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Smoketown Studio Apartments | $1,082 | $200 | $2,838 |
| Smoketown 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,366 | $200 | $3,603 |
| Smoketown 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,639 | $775 | $4,365 |
| Smoketown 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,827 | $909 | $5,687 |
| Smoketown 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,568 | $619 | $7,930 |
